Accounts Receivable Specialist II Duties Include:

  • Processing of electronic and paper remits, including the posting of patient portions, denials, adjustments, contractual allowance and recoupments.
  • Reconciles daily reporting from multiple bank accounts to receivable accounts.
  • Accurately posts patient and insurance payor payments to patient accounts timely, calculates and enters contractual adjustments, and patient discounts.
  • Identifies and reports issues, discrepancies, and opportunities for improvement to management.
  • Train and mentor teammates.

Qualifications:

  • High School diploma or equivalent.
  • 3+ years medical and/or behavioral billing experience, especially in the area of account and payment reconciliation.
  • 3+ years' experience with medical terminology and using an electronic medical record and billing system.
  • Demonstrated knowledge of HCPC's, CPT, and diagnosis coding.
  • Intermediate knowledge of Microsoft suite, especially excel functions and tools.
  • Experience interacting with external payers and stakeholders.
  • Experience mentoring and training others on claims and/or coding functions.
  • This role is a nondriving position. This position is performed at one location and does not require travel to various Terros Health centers. May be 18 years of age and with less than two years' driving experience or no driving experience.
  • Ability to work cooperatively and collaboratively with all levels of employees, management, and external agencies.
  • Must pass a TB Test.
